In computing length of creditable service under the Nebraska State Patrol Retirement Act, such service shall include the years of service with the Nebraska State Patrol, permanent force, as established by the law creating the Nebraska State Patrol computed to the nearest one-twelfth year and shall only include such years during which the person was a contributing member of the Nebraska State Patrol Retirement System. Length of creditable service shall also include credit for time served in the armed forces pursuant to section 81-2034. For subsection (2) of section 81-2031 only, service shall also include credit for vesting pursuant to sections 60-1304, 81-2016, and 81-2031.02.
